What is an Undergraduate Program?

An undergraduate program is the first level of university study after completing high school. It usually leads to a Bachelor’s degree (like B.A., B.Sc., B.Eng., or BBA).


Who is it for?

  • Students who have completed their higher secondary education (HSC, A-levels, IB, or equivalent).

  • Students aiming to gain a first university degree in a specific field (Business, Engineering, IT, Medicine, Arts, etc.).

  • International students who want to study abroad or in their home country.


Country-wise Requirements (Typical Examples):

CountryDegree LengthAcademic RequirementsEnglish RequirementsNotes / Key Points
USA~4 yearsHigh school diploma; SAT/ACT sometimes requiredTOEFL/IELTS/DuolingoFlexible majors, internships, Optional Practical Training (OPT) for work experience
UK~3 yearsA-levels / IB / HSC; Foundation Year if neededIELTS 6.0–6.5Apply via UCAS; strong global recognition
Australia~3–4 yearsHSC or equivalent; Foundation Year if requiredIELTS 6.0–6.5Post-study work opportunities; industry-focused programs
Canada~3–4 yearsHigh school diploma with strong grades; SAT/ACT sometimesIELTS 6.0–6.5 / TOEFLWork while study and post-graduation work permits; provincial differences
New Zealand~3–4 yearsNCEA or HSC equivalent; some Foundation YearIELTS 6.0Safe, multicultural, student-friendly environment
Netherlands~3 yearsSecondary school diploma / IB / A-levelIELTS 6.5 / TOEFL 80+Many English-taught programs; application via university or Studielink
South Korea~4 yearsHigh school diplomaTOEFL/IELTS for English programs; TOPIK for Korean programsIncreasing English-medium programs, strong tech & engineering focus
Malaysia~3–4 yearsHSC / Equivalent; some programs accept credit transferMOI (Medium of Instruction) or IELTS/TOEFL/DuolingoAffordable tuition, English-taught programs, multicultural environment
Cyprus~3–4 yearsHSC or equivalentIELTS 5.5–6.0Affordable tuition, English-taught programs
Hungary~3–4 yearsHSC or equivalent; sometimes Foundation YearIELTS/TOEFL or MOIEnglish-taught Medicine, Engineering, Business; EU recognized
Italy~3–4 yearsHigh school diplomaEnglish or Italian proficiencyEnglish or Italian programs; affordable tuition
France~3–4 yearsHigh school diploma / BacFrench or English proficiencyPublic universities affordable; some English-taught programs
